10 Simple Habits for a Healthier Life

Living a healthier life doesn’t require a complete overhaul of your routine. In fact, small, consistent changes often have the biggest impact. The key is to focus on habits that are easy to maintain and support your physical, mental, and emotional well-being.

Here are 10 simple habits you can start today for a healthier, happier life:


1. Drink More Water

Hydration is essential for digestion, energy, skin health, and more. Aim for about 8 glasses (2 liters) a day, more if you’re active or in a hot climate.

???? Tip: Start your day with a glass of water before coffee or tea.


2. Move Your Body Daily

You don’t need a gym membership to stay active. Just 20–30 minutes of walking, stretching, or dancing can boost your mood and support heart and joint health.

????‍♂️ Tip: Take the stairs, walk during phone calls, or do home workouts.


3. Prioritize Sleep

Aim for 7–9 hours of quality sleep each night. Sleep helps your body recover, your mind stay sharp, and your mood stay stable.

???? Tip: Create a relaxing bedtime routine and avoid screens before bed.


4. Eat More Whole Foods

Focus on f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ats. These foods provide essential nutrients and help prevent chronic disease.

???? Tip: Fill half your plate with vegetables at every meal.


5. Practice Gratitude

Taking just a few minutes each day to reflect on what you’re thankful for can improve mental health and reduce stress.

???? Tip: Keep a gratitude journal or list 3 things you’re grateful for each morning.


6. Take Deep Breaths

When you’re stressed, pause and take a few slow, deep breaths. This activates your body’s relaxation response and calms your mind.

???? Tip: Try the 4-7-8 technique: inhale for 4 seconds, hold for 7, exhale for 8.


7. Spend Time Outdoors

Sunlight boosts vitamin D, enhances mood, and reconnects you with nature. Just 10–15 minutes outside a day can make a difference.

???? Tip: Eat lunch outside, go for a walk, or garden in your free time.


8. Limit Added Sugar

Too much sugar can lead to energy crashes, weight gain, and increased disease risk. Start by cutting back on sugary drinks and snacks.

???? Tip: Read labels and choose natural sweetness from fruits instead.


9. Connect with Others

Strong social connections are linked to longer, healthier lives. Make time to talk, laugh, and share with friends and family.

???? Tip: Schedule regular check-ins with loved ones, even just a quick call.


10. Learn Something New

Challenging your brain keeps it sharp and boosts confidence. Whether it’s reading, cooking, or learning a new skill, keep growing.

???? Tip: Dedicate 15–30 minutes a day to something that inspires you.


Final Thoughts

A healthy life isn’t about being perfect—it’s about being intentional. Start with one or two of these habits and build gradually. Over time, these small changes will lead to big results in your health and happiness.
